1999 gmc yukon, ignition switch will not turn,why?


Sent to Car Experts February 21, 2006 11:37 a.m.

ignition is locked in the off position.

Optional Information:
1999 GMC yukon v-8

Already Tried:
wiggle the steering wheel, all is locked.
Customer (name blocked for privacy)
Status: Closed   Value: $8   
Answer
February 21, 2006 1:49 p.m. (2 hours and 12 minutes later)
ACCEPTED Check Mark

The ignition switch (key cylinder has wear in it). If you wiggle it long enough sometimes it will turn, but you will have to get the lock cylinder replaced. The tumblers do not move enough to release the lock that keeps it from turning. Or the lock keepers have come loose. I have replace many lock cylinders for this. Hope this helps.
